The local newspaper has letters to the editor from 60,000 people. If this number represents 25​% of all of the​ newspaper's read

ers, how many readers does the newspaper​ have?

The newspaper has 240000 readers

<em><u>Solution:</u></em>

Given that, Local newspaper has letters to the editor from 60,000 people

This number represents 25​% of all of the​ newspaper's readers

To find: Number of newspaper readers

Let "x" be the number of all newspaper readers

From given statement,

60,000 people = 25​% of all of the​ newspaper's readers

60, 000 = 25 % of x

Solve the above expression for "x"

25 % of x = 60000

25 \% \times x = 60000\\\\\frac{25}{100} \times x = 60000\\\\ 0.25x = 60000\\\\x = \frac{60000}{0.25}\\\\x = 240000

Thus the newspaper has 240000 readers
